1.     Call to Order - Chair Mansell called the meeting to order at 9:24 a.m.

2.     Committee Business - Approval of the November 20, 1996, State and Local Affairs Interim Committee minutes .

     MOTION:    Sen. McAllister moved to approve the minutes of the November 20, 1996 State and Local Affairs meeting. The motion passed unanimously with Sen. Steiner and Rep. Stephens absent for the vote.

    Members of the committee and staff introduced themselves.

3.     1997 General Session Review - John Cannon briefed the committee on actions during the 1997 general session in the Government Operations area. He distributed handouts titled "State and Local Affairs Interim Committee _ 1996 Committee Bills, 1997 General Session Action," and "Government Operations Select Bills Passed _ 1997 General Session."

4.    Government Operations Overview - Brief presentations were given to the committee from the following departments of government:

     Department of Human Resource Management - Karen Suzuki-Okabe, Executive Director, provided a summary of the Department of Human Resource Management. Handouts titled "Employee Salary Increases," "Employment Turnover Rates," and "Employee Pay Range Position," were also distributed. Committee members asked questions of Ms. Okabe. She discussed COLA (Cost of Living Adjustment) vs. merit increases, and distributed another

handout titled "Impact of Legislative Compensation Decisions." Rep. Stephens suggested that this issue be studied more extensively and Sen. McAllister said he would also ask for this information to be given to the Executive Appropriations Committee.

     Lieutenant Governor's Office - Olene Walker, Lieutenant Governor, reported that the Elections Office is running smoothly. She informed the committee of issues being addressed to simplify the process. She discussed issues relating to Political Issues Committee reporting, provisional ballots, and lobbyist disclosure.

     Governor's Office of Planning and Budget - Lynne Koga, Director, briefed the committee on the functions of the Governor's Office of Planning and Budget. She explained handouts titled "Governor's Office of Planning and Budget," and "1997 Economic Report to the Governor."

     Attorney General's Office - Reed Richards, Criminal Chief Deputy, Executive Division; and Jerrold Jensen, Division Chief, Public Affairs Division; distributed a handout titled "Attorney General's Legal Update for Legislators." They briefed the committee on the functions of the Attorney General's Office and reported on some of the cases the office has been, and is currently, involved in. Rep. Stephens asked who, in the state, has the authority to decide when to accept a settlement of a case. Mr. Richards and Mr. Jensen responded to the question. Mr. Fellows clarified the statutory process for approval of settlements.

     Utah State Treasurer - Richard Ellis, Deputy Treasurer, explained the responsibilities of the Treasurer's Department. He noted two issues which could potentially result in legislation:
(1) an overall cleanup of the Treasurer's duties; and (2) the Uniform Unclaimed Property Act.

     Department of Administrative Services - Raylene Ireland, Executive Director, distributed an organizational chart titled, "Utah Department of Administrative Services Division and Division Directors." She explained the functions of the department and upcoming changes. She said the organizational chart will change as of January 1998, and explained the changes to the committee.

     Utah State Auditor - Auston Johnson briefly explained the functions of the State Auditor to the committee. He discussed recently passed legislation which cleaned up the Auditor's statutory duties.

     Utah Public Employees Association - Melanie Holland, Chair of the Board of Directors, gave history information on the UPEA. Nancy Sechrest, Executive Director, suggested that Master Study Resolutions items 151, 152, and 158 be considered for review by the committee.

5.    Presentation and Discussion of Potential Study Items - John Cannon distributed and reviewed a handout titled "Government Operations Interim Committee Potential Study Items _ 1997 Interim." Chair Mansell asked the committee to prioritize the top issues of interest and return the study items sheets to staff. The chairs would then submit a list of potential study items to Legislative Management for approval.

    MOTION:     Rep. Hendrickson moved to adjourn the meeting. The motion passed unanimously with Rep. Stephens absent for the vote. The meeting adjourned at 11:29 a.m.
